// Function to run before executing a template.
var PreExecuteTemplateHook = func() {}
func ExecuteSimpleTemplate(template *template.Template, w http.ResponseWriter, r *http.Request) {
w.Header().Set("Content-Type", "text/html")
PreExecuteTemplateHook()
if err := template.Execute(w, struct{}{}); err != nil {
httputils.ReportError(w, err, fmt.Sprintf("Failed to expand template: %v", err), http.StatusInternalServerError)
return
}
}
func GetQualifiedCustomWebpages(customWebpages, benchmarkArgs string) ([]string, error) {
qualifiedWebpages := []string{}
if customWebpages != "" {
if !strings.Contains(benchmarkArgs, util.USE_LIVE_SITES_FLAGS) {
return nil, errors.New("Cannot use custom webpages without " + util.USE_LIVE_SITES_FLAGS)
}
r := csv.NewReader(strings.NewReader(customWebpages))
for {
records, err := r.Read()
if err == io.EOF {
break
}
if err != nil {
return nil, err
}
for _, record := range records {
if strings.TrimSpace(record) == "" {
// Skip empty webpages.
continue
}
var qualifiedWebpage string
if strings.HasPrefix(record, "http://") || strings.HasPrefix(record, "https://") {
qualifiedWebpage = record
} else if len(strings.Split(record, ".")) > 2 {
qualifiedWebpage = fmt.Sprintf("http://%s", record)
} else {
qualifiedWebpage = fmt.Sprintf("http://www.%s", record)
}
qualifiedWebpages = append(qualifiedWebpages, qualifiedWebpage)
}
}
}
return qualifiedWebpages, nil
}
// Returns true if the string is non-empty, unless strconv.ParseBool parses the string as false.
func ParseBoolFormValue(string string) bool {
if string == "" {
return false
} else if val, err := strconv.ParseBool(string); val == false && err == nil {
return false
} else {
return true
}
}
